Abstract: When it comes to the opening of an account for a new customer there is a lot at stake. A new customer’s experience in the first 90 days drives whether they will add additional banking services or discontinue their account altogether. An effective enrollment process can provide a positive customer experience that sets the stage for cross selling of new and existing customers. Simultaneously, a more streamlined system will improve customer communications, increase organizational productivity and decrease the high costs of customer acquisition.
